Truck making clicking noise, w/lights, but will not start. on 2007 Toyota Sequoia

Truck was running fine. I parked for 1-hour and tried to restart. Dash lights up, clicking sound, w/headlamps that go off quickly, and the engine does not turn over at all--absolutely no cranking.

Is this battery or starter, or something else?

ck battery cables and battery 1st if thee ok poss starter issue. if its orig battery it might be bad as it is 6 yrs old
Thanks. It is a second battery from WalMart, that was replaced in 2009. I've pulled it out and I'm taking it to WM to have it checked and replaced if necessary.

The starter never showed any signs of trouble. No hesitation, or odd noises. I did recently just replace the headlamp bulbs, and I have no idea if I didn't replace the battery terminal cables correctly. Perhaps that was part of the issue as well.

I'll let you know what I find.
